Jewish humour meets Afro-American enthusiasm
By a fool-play of a fate, in the USA-1969 seventy year old Jew-shop-owner is accidentally made hosting a nine-year old Afro-American boy visiting this place as a summer exchange charity program participant.
Their relations and bond present a significant picture of then American civic affairs and testify to a long way an American society made since Vietnam era to nowadays.
Very nice performing and generally funny stuff.
